What Type of Medicine is Sedrofen?

Sedrofen is a prescription-only medicine whose therapeutic activity is driven by the active ingredient Cefadroxil. It is classified as an Antibiotic, belonging specifically to the cephalosporin family of drugs. Cefadroxil is further specified as a first-generation cephalosporin, a classification derived from its chemical structure and established spectrum of activity. The structure of Cefadroxil is clinically recognized as a semisynthetic beta-lactam antibiotic capable of fighting infection.

The medicine is intended for oral administration and is typically provided as a single active ingredient product in multiple dosage forms, including capsules, tablets, or a powder used to create an oral suspension. The availability of the pediatric oral suspension form makes Cefadroxil a versatile choice for a broad patient group.

Composition and General Purpose of Cefadroxil

The core purpose of Cefadroxil is to combat bacterial infections through a definitive bactericidal effect. This function is achieved by interfering with the vital process of bacterial cell wall synthesis, meaning the medication actively destroys susceptible bacteria rather than simply stopping their growth.

By disrupting the formation of the cell's rigid structure, the medicine effectively causes the bacterial cell to break down and die, providing the general therapeutic benefit of clearing bacterial proliferation. Cephalosporin antibiotics, like Cefadroxil, are well-established for their cell-killing mechanisms against susceptible organisms, confirming its action is geared toward eliminating the root cause of the bacterial presence.

What side effects are possible with Sedrofen?

Possible Side Effects and Safety Information

The safety profile of Sedrofen, as documented in authoritative regulatory sources, details potential adverse reactions categorized by frequency and affected body systems.

Commonly Reported Side Effects

The most frequently reported adverse reactions affect the Gastrointestinal system and the Skin and subcutaneous tissue. Common events include diarrhea, nausea, vomiting, stomach pain, pruritus (itching), and rash/allergic exanthema.

Serious and Clinically Significant Adverse Reactions

The following are recognized as rare but potentially serious events and are critical components of the official safety profile:

  • Hypersensitivity Reactions: Severe, acute allergic responses, including anaphylactic shock and serious skin conditions such as Stevens-Johnson syndrome and Toxic Epidermal Necrolysis, have been reported. Cross-sensitivity with other beta-lactam antibiotics (e.g., penicillins) has been clearly documented.
  • Gastrointestinal Complications: The development of Clostridioides difficile-associated diarrhea (CDAD), which can range in severity from mild diarrhea to fatal pseudomembranous colitis, is a documented risk associated with nearly all antibacterial agents, including Sedrofen.
  • Organ and Blood Disorders: Rare cases of hepatic dysfunction (e.g., transient elevation of liver enzymes) and renal dysfunction (e.g., interstitial nephritis) are documented. Certain serious blood and lymphatic system disorders, such as agranulocytosis and thrombocytopenia, have been reported, particularly with prolonged use.

Safety Restrictions and Population Considerations

Sedrofen is formally contraindicated in individuals with known hypersensitivity to the cephalosporin class of antibiotics. Caution is required in patients with a history of gastrointestinal disease, particularly colitis. The drug should also be used with caution in the presence of markedly impaired renal function (creatinine clearance rate less than 50 mL/min/1.73 m^2), as this may necessitate careful monitoring and potential dose adjustment. Prolonged use carries the risk of superinfection due to the overgrowth of non-susceptible organisms. The occurrence of certain neurological symptoms has been noted with high doses in cases of impaired kidney function.

What should I know about interactions with other medicines?

Interactions with other medicines and products

This section describes the officially documented interaction patterns for Sedrofen (Cefadroxil) as defined by government regulatory agencies.

Pharmacokinetic and Exposure Interactions

The regulatory profile documents a pharmacokinetic interaction with Probenecid, an agent that inhibits renal tubular secretion. Co-administration of Probenecid reduces the renal elimination of Cefadroxil, which results in increased and prolonged plasma concentrations of the antibiotic. No specific interaction involving the Cytochrome P450 (CYP) enzyme system is officially documented.

Pharmacodynamic and Toxicity Interactions

Interaction reports indicate potential for enhanced effects when Sedrofen is used alongside other medicines. Co-administration with Aminoglycoside antibiotics or Loop Diuretics (such as Furosemide) may lead to an enhanced nephrotoxic effect. Additionally, the medicine may potentiate the anticoagulant effect of Vitamin K Antagonists (e.g., Warfarin), which increases the overall risk of bleeding.

Procedural and Administration Constraints

The use of Cefadroxil has been associated with a potential positive result on the Direct Coombs’ test, a procedural constraint that should be considered during laboratory testing. For administration, the official documents state that Sedrofen may be taken with or without food; administration with food is noted as a condition that may improve gastrointestinal tolerability.

Population-Specific Considerations

In patients with markedly impaired renal function, slower clearance leads to increased systemic exposure to Cefadroxil. This condition requires caution, as the heightened exposure increases the potential for concentration-dependent adverse effects.

Dosage and Administration Information

Administration and Dosing Schedule

Sedrofen (Cefadroxil) is administered exclusively by the oral route, available in capsule, tablet, and reconstituted oral suspension forms. For the majority of adult infections, the standard total daily dose ranges from 1 g to 2 g, administered either once daily or in two divided doses. The full course of therapy must be completed to prevent bacterial resistance; specifically, treatment for infections caused by Group A streptococci requires a minimum duration of 10 consecutive days.


Contextual Usage and Preparation

The medication may be taken with or without food, as administration with food may help mitigate potential gastrointestinal discomfort. For the liquid oral suspension, the product must be shaken well before each use and measured with a calibrated device. Certain high-dose uses, such as endocarditis prophylaxis, mandate a single 2 g dose administered precisely one hour prior to the procedure.


Population and Procedural Adjustments

Dose adjustments are required for adults with renal impairment (creatinine clearance leq 50 mL/min/1.73 m^2), necessitating a modified dosing interval based on the degree of impairment. If a dose is missed, it should be taken as soon as remembered unless it is near the time for the next scheduled dose; in this scenario, the missed dose must be skipped, and the dose should not be doubled.

Q: How quickly does Sedrofen start to work?

A: Sedrofen is classified as a medicine that is rapidly absorbed after oral administration. According to official product information, concentrations of the drug in the blood generally reach their peak within 1.5 to 2 hours following a dose.

Q: How long does the effect of one Sedrofen dose usually last?

A: The half-life of Sedrofen (Cefadroxil) is approximately 1 to 2 hours in adults who have normal kidney function. Official pharmacological data indicates that more than 90% of the active medicine is usually cleared from the body through the urine within 24 hours of dosing.

Q: What if I forget to take my Sedrofen dose?

A: If a dose is missed, it should be taken as soon as it is remembered. However, if it is almost time for the next scheduled dose, the missed dose must be skipped. Official guidance specifies that the dose should not be doubled to compensate for the one that was forgotten.

Q: Can people with mild kidney issues take Sedrofen?

A: Sedrofen requires caution when used by individuals with impaired kidney function. The dose must be adjusted for moderate to severe impairment, which is defined as a creatinine clearance of less than or equal to 50 mL/min/1.73 m^2. Monitoring of kidney function may be necessary during treatment.

Q: Are there common drug classes that interact badly with Sedrofen?

A: Yes, official information documents several important drug interactions. These include a pharmacokinetic interaction with Probenecid, which increases the amount of Sedrofen in the body. Additionally, there is a potential for enhanced nephrotoxic effects when used with Aminoglycoside antibiotics and certain Loop Diuretics.

How should Sedrofen be stored and disposed of?

How to Store and Dispose of Sedrofen (Cefadroxil)

Official storage conditions for Sedrofen differ based on the form of the medicine, and all forms must be kept out of the reach of children.

Dosage Form Required Storage Condition Stability/Handling Rules
Capsules/Tablets (Dry) Store at controlled room temperature (20 C to 25 C) in the original, tightly closed container. Keep away from heat and moisture. Do not freeze.
Oral Suspension (Liquid) Store the reconstituted suspension in the refrigerator (2 C to 8 C). Must be discarded after 14 days; do not freeze the liquid.

Disposal must follow local guidelines; unused or expired Sedrofen should generally be disposed of through a drug take-back program. The medicine should not be flushed down a sink or toilet.
